    Hello,

    I just wanted to know if Nod32 protects the registry in some way.


    I've seen on the ~Link removed. Site is not recommended.~ , "registry protection" is not checked for Eset. I just wanted to be sure if this info is correct.

    The program's registry entries and files have been protected since v. 4.0. V5 has introduced HIPS which added protection of other crucial registry keys and also allows the user to create and configure custom rules.
